TICKET DL-407 — Signature verification failing on Wayfinder deep-link routes

For new team members: Wayfinder validates every deep-link payload against a signed route manifest before the mobile client will route. Since Monday's build, verification fails on all Android installs because the embedded manifest was signed with a key that has since been rotated out. The fix is to re-sign the manifest and ship a point release. Re-sign using the key below.

signing key of bagap-yawep = bky13_TbfT6ZMUoGJo2

Handover Note — Loyalty Programme Overhaul

From: R. Castellan, outgoing Director of Retail
To: M. Obreht, incoming

Status: BrightPoints redesign is 60% scoped. Tier structure agreed; redemption engine vendor shortlist down to two. Heads of department briefed except Merchandising. Budget frozen pending Q4 review. Risks: legacy card migration, churn among Silver members. Do not announce earn-rate changes before the Velden pilot concludes. Full context on where this programme is heading sits below.

confidential, kagep-kahof: Druokax Systems plans to lower the Ulaath list price by 53 percent in March.

The proposed plan adds 34 roles across Veldane Systems, weighted toward the Corsa platform engineering group and the Tillbrook support center. Attrition modeling assumes 9% voluntary turnover, consistent with the past two years. Contractor conversion accounts for 11 of the new positions, reducing agency spend meaningfully. Regional salary benchmarks have been refreshed for the Ostlin market. One assumption underpinning the second-half hiring wave is tied to a sensitive matter noted below.

internal memo for tafog-kageg: Headcount on the Tamion team goes from 9 to 94 by the end of May. Gross margin on Tamion came in at 23 percent against a plan of 58 percent.

## Deployment

The Glimmerwick encoding detector runs as a sidecar next to the upload service. Deploys go through the standard Harrowden pipeline; no manual steps. Support note: misdetected files (usually old Windows exports) can be re-queued with the `redetect` action in the admin panel — no engineering ticket needed. Confidence threshold and fallback charset are set per environment, not per tenant. The detector reads the following values at startup:

service settings:
[casax]
port = 6379
team = rusir
host = casax.zemvarhq.corp
region = outer-4
access_code = ac_9808ce
timeout_ms = 1500